St. Hilda's Home.
The matron of St. Hilda's Children's Home, Otane, acknowledges with thanks the following gi^ts:— Jam, Mrs Henry Tiffin, Mrs McLean, Messrs Tiekner, Wood, Dryden ; books and toys, Mrs Henry Tiffin; meat, Mr George Williams, Otane Harvest Thanksgiving, Mrs Gilmour, Mr Whibley; eggs and butter, r MrGeorge Williams; fruit, Mr- Edward Bibby, Harvest Thanksgiving offerings, St. James (Otane), St. John's (Dannevirke), Waipukurau,: (per Rev. Stace), Woodville; . milk, Mr Cowley; vegetables and potatoes, Mr Phillips (Dannevirke) ;, onions, Mrs Watts, Mr George Williams; cakes, Mrs J. Todd, Mr F. Ticknef r Mr Whibley, Mr F. D. Waller, Otane - Horticultural Showj vegetables, Rata- ' mau (per Rev. Stepherisoii), Mr H. J. Pratley; potatoes, Mr Herbert Gilbertson, Mrs Williams (Clareinch) ; sauces and jelly, Messrs Tiekner, Wood, Dryden; clothing, Mrs C. Williams, Miss Sallie Williams, Mrs T. Hogg, Frank Nelson; apples, Mr W. Williams; strainers and post, Mr G. C. Williams; bulbs, Rev. G. Davidson. ' ■ '
